body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;margin:0}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}:root{--primary:#f5f5f4;--secondary:#7694b6;--black:#333;--white:#030303;--box-shadow:0 .5rem 1rem rgba(0,0,0,.1)}::-webkit-scrollbar{width:10px}::-webkit-scrollbar-thumb{background-color:#0080ff;border-radius:5px}::-webkit-scrollbar-track{background-color:#252525}.navbar-toggler{background-color:#fff}.navbar-toggler-icon{transition:background-color 1s ease}body,main{background-color:#f5f5f5}body{overflow-x:hidden;padding-top:4%}*{border:none;box-sizing:border-box;font-family:Poppins,sans-serif;margin:0;outline:none;padding:0;text-decoration:none;transition:.2s linear}#app-header{background-color:#0a0a0a!important;display:flex;height:10vh;padding:0!important;position:fixed;top:0;width:100vw;z-index:1000000}#app-header img{object-fit:contain;padding:0!important;width:310px}.nav-link{color:#fff!important;font-size:1.2rem;font-weight:600}.nav-link:hover{color:#0080ff!important}#navbarNav{padding-right:5%}label{color:#f8f8f8}form{background-color:#0a0a0a;border-radius:10px;padding:30px 25px}form h2{color:#f0f8ff;font-size:1.6rem;text-align:center}.col-auto{align-items:end;justify-content:end;margin-top:50px}.form-label{margin:0}.bienvenida{background-color:#000;color:#ebebeb;font-size:20px;padding:8px}.email{color:#fff;margin-top:10vh;text-decoration:none}.email:hover{color:#0080ff}.imgEmail{margin-right:15px}.section1{background-image:url(/static/media/Computadora%20negra.69d48407f8ffd935789d.jpg);background-size:cover;display:flex;height:90vh}.filtro{background-color:#030303;-webkit-filter:opacity(.5);filter:opacity(.5);height:90%;position:absolute;width:100%;z-index:1}.section1-1{align-items:flex-start;display:flex;flex-direction:column;gap:25px;padding:14vh 3vw 0;width:50%;z-index:2}.imgHero{margin-top:30px;width:70%}input{background-color:#0076ec}.textHero1{font-size:2.7rem;font-weight:600}.textHero,.textHero1{color:#f8f8f8;text-align:start}.textHero{font-size:1.3rem;margin-top:-25px}.botonhero3{background-color:#0080ff;border-radius:20px;color:#fff;font-size:20px;font-weight:500;height:2.6em;margin-top:25px;width:13.2em}.section1-2{padding:120px 10vw 0;width:50%;z-index:2}.section2{height:85vh;width:100%}.section2-1{background-color:#111112;display:flex;height:30%;justify-content:center;padding-left:5vw;padding-right:5vw}.ventajas{align-items:center;color:#fff;display:flex;font-weight:600;height:100%;justify-content:space-evenly;text-align:center;width:24%}.tituloVentaja{font-weight:900;margin-bottom:5px}.textVent{font-size:.8rem;font-weight:100}.contVentajasText{display:flex;flex-direction:column;padding-left:15px;width:77%}.ventajas img{background-color:#fff;border-radius:50%;margin:0;object-fit:contain;width:22%}.section2-2{display:flex;gap:5px;height:70%}.testimonio{align-items:center;display:flex;flex-direction:column;gap:30px;justify-content:center;padding:30px;width:33.3%}.testimonio p{font-weight:500;text-align:center}.img-testimonio{object-fit:cover;width:50%}#testimonio4{display:none}.boton{display:flex;justify-content:center;text-decoration:none;width:100%}.vector{margin-left:10px;width:20px}.vector2{width:30px}.col-auto{display:flex;gap:15px;justify-content:center}#btn-pixel{background-color:#333;border:0;border-radius:20px;box-shadow:inset 0 0 15px #d1d5db;font-weight:0;height:3rem;margin:auto;width:50%}#btn-pixel:hover{background-color:#0080ff}#btn-pixel2{background-color:#111112;border:.5px solid gray!important;border:0;border-radius:20px;box-shadow:inset 0 0 15px #d1d5db;font-weight:0;height:3rem;margin:auto;width:50%}#btn-pixel2:hover,.botonhero2{background-color:#0080ff}.botonhero2{border:2px solid var(--color);border-radius:15px;color:#fff;display:inline-block;font-family:inherit;font-size:17px;font-weight:500;height:3.6em;line-height:2.5em;margin-top:80px;overflow:hidden;position:relative;transition:color .5s;width:13.2em;z-index:1}.botonhero2:before{background:var(--color);border-radius:50%;content:"";height:150px;position:absolute;width:200px;z-index:-1}.botonhero2:hover{background-color:#0076ec;color:#fff}.botonhero2:before{left:100%;top:100%;transition:all .7s}.botonhero2:hover:before{left:-30px;top:-30px}.botonhero2:active:before{background:#3a0ca3;transition:background 0s}.botonhero4{background-color:#0080ff;border:2px solid var(--color);border-radius:35px;color:#fff;display:inline-block;font-family:inherit;font-size:17px;font-weight:500;height:4.6em;line-height:2.5em;margin-top:50%;overflow:hidden;position:relative;transition:color .5s;width:16.2em;z-index:1}.botonhero4:before{background:var(--color);border-radius:50%;content:"";height:150px;position:absolute;width:200px;z-index:-1}.botonhero4:hover{background-color:#1b6ea5;color:#fff}.botonhero4:before{left:100%;top:100%;transition:all .7s}.botonhero4:hover:before{left:-30px;top:-30px}.botonhero4:active:before{background:#3a0ca3;transition:background 0s}.section3{background-color:#f5f5f5;height:160vh}.quienesSomos{align-items:center;background-color:#eee (233,233,233);display:flex;flex-direction:column;height:50%;margin-top:-110px;width:100%}.infoImgQuienesSomos{display:flex;gap:5px;height:100%;width:100%}.info{align-items:center;display:flex;flex-direction:column;justify-content:center;text-align:center;width:64%}.sobreNosotrosTitulo{margin:0;text-align:start;width:80%}.sobreNosotrosTitulo2{font-size:38px;font-weight:800;text-align:start;width:80%}.textNosotros{font-size:.9rem;font-weight:550;text-align:start;width:80%}.info2{display:flex;justify-content:center;width:36%}.info2 img{object-fit:contain;width:80%}.herramientas{display:flex;flex-direction:column;gap:8%}.bordeGris,.herramientas{height:20%;margin-top:-50px}.bordeGris{background-color:#f5f5f5}.herramientasusadas{margin-left:6.4%}.contHerramientas{display:flex;flex-wrap:wrap;gap:20px;height:70%;justify-content:center;margin-top:1%;padding-left:4.4%;padding-right:4%}.herrameinta{align-items:center;background-color:#131313;display:flex;height:25%;justify-content:space-between;padding-left:1%;padding-right:1%;width:18%}.imgHerr{width:70px}.nameHerr{color:#fff;font-size:1.2rem;margin:0}.proyectos{align-items:center;display:flex;flex-direction:column;height:40%;width:100%}.proyectosTitulo{font-size:1.5rem;font-weight:800;margin-bottom:5px;margin-top:35px}.proyectosCont{display:flex;height:100%;justify-content:space-around;width:100%}.itemProyecto{align-items:center;display:flex;height:75%;padding:30px;width:30%}.itemProyecto a{display:flex;justify-content:center}.imgProyectos{width:90%}.itemProyecto a:hover{-webkit-filter:brightness(.5);filter:brightness(.5)}.review{background-image:url(/static/media/Portada%20Facebook%20copia%20-%20Sierras%20de%20Calamuchita%201.430e80da39b089a8af3a.png);background-size:cover;display:flex;height:25rem;margin:3rem 0;position:relative;width:100%}.review .review-slider{background-color:#fff;border-radius:20px;box-shadow:2px 2px 15px;color:#030303;color:var(--white);height:110%;margin-left:35rem;margin-right:40rem;margin-top:-2rem;padding:3% 2rem 2rem;width:70%}.textoComentarios{margin:0;padding:0!important}.textoComent{display:flex;flex-direction:column;font-size:1rem!important;height:65%;justify-content:space-between;text-align:start}.review .slide{text-align:center}.review .slide .heading,.review .slide p{color:#030303;color:var(--white)}.review .slide p{font-size:1.5rem;line-height:1.8;padding-bottom:1.5rem;padding-top:2rem}.review .slide .user{align-items:center;border-radius:.5rem;display:flex;gap:1.5rem;justify-content:start;padding:0}#userInfo{text-align:start}.review .slide .user img{background-color:#afafaf;border-radius:50%;height:10rem;object-fit:cover;padding:0!important;width:10rem}.review .slide .user h3{color:#333;color:var(--black);font-size:2rem;padding-bottom:.5rem}.review .slide .user i{color:#f5f5f4;color:var(--primary);font-size:1.3rem}.navbar-toggler[aria-expanded=true]{background-color:#f3f3f3;border-color:#2d1eff}.navbar-collapse.show{background-color:#000;border-radius:5px;padding:8px;z-index:10!important}.swiper-pagination{display:flex;justify-content:center;width:90%}.vector-coment{height:15px;margin-top:15px;object-fit:contain;width:100%}.btnWpp{bottom:5vh;left:1vw;position:fixed;z-index:999}.btnWpp img{width:110px}.btnWpp:hover{scale:1.2;transition:1}.botonfinal{display:flex;justify-content:center;margin-left:-40%;text-decoration:none;width:100%}footer{background-color:#0a0a0a;display:flex;flex-direction:column;height:35vh}.redes{display:flex;height:70%;width:100%}.footerSection1{align-items:start;color:#fff;display:flex;flex-direction:column;font-size:32px;justify-content:center;line-height:1.5;padding-left:5%;padding-right:2%;width:50%}.spanFooter{color:#0080ff;font-size:34px;font-weight:700}.text2Footer{font-size:.8rem}.footerSection2{width:50%}.copi{display:flex;height:30%;justify-content:space-evenly;width:100%}.textFooter{align-items:center;color:#fff;display:flex;margin:0}.logoFoter{object-fit:contain}.divHr{display:flex;justify-content:center}.hr{background-color:#fff;border-top:none!important;color:#fff!important;height:2px;margin:0!important;width:90%}.footerLinks{align-items:center;display:flex;gap:6%;height:45%;justify-content:center;padding-top:2%;width:100%}.footerLinks a{color:#fff;font-size:1.2rem;font-weight:700;text-decoration:none}.footerLinks a:hover{color:#0080ff}.footerRedes{align-items:start;display:flex;gap:6%;height:55%;justify-content:center;padding:10px}.botonhero5{background-color:#0080ff;border-radius:20px;color:#fff;font-size:20px;font-weight:500;height:2.6em;width:13.2em}.botonhero5:hover{background-color:#0063c7}.botonfinal{margin-left:-150%}@media (min-width:320px) and (max-width:1150px){.review .review-slider{margin-left:2rem;margin-right:7rem;padding:40px 20px}.review .slide p{font-size:1rem}#btn-pixel{width:100%}.imgTecnos{width:300px!important}}@media (min-width:320px) and (max-width:768px){.herramientasusadas{font-size:1.5rem;font-weight:800;margin:0;text-align:center}}@media (min-width:769px) and (max-width:1149px){.herramientasusadas{margin:0 0 0 60px}}@media (min-width:1151px) and (max-width:1950px){.review .review-slider{margin-left:2rem;margin-right:27%!important}.review .slide p{font-size:1.3rem}.review .review-slider{margin-left:10%;margin-right:35%}}@media (min-width:320px) and (max-width:440px) and (min-height:600px) and (max-height:840px){.App-logo{width:80%}.section1{height:140vh!important}.section2-1{padding-top:2%!important}.quienesSomos{height:140vh!important}.herramientas{height:60vh}.proyectos{height:100vh!important}.review{height:80vh!important;margin-top:110vh!important}footer{height:42vh!important}.logoFoter{width:35%!important}}@media (min-width:320px) and (max-width:408px){.section1-2{padding-left:3%;padding-right:3%;padding-top:30%}}@media (min-width:320px) and (max-width:850px){#app-header img{object-fit:contain;padding:0!important;width:235px}.section1{display:flex;flex-direction:column;height:115vh!important;width:100%}.bienvenida{font-size:.5rem}.textHero1{font-size:1.3rem}.textHero{font-size:.8rem}.boton1,.email{display:none}.section1-1{height:22rem;padding-left:5%;width:100%}#btn-pixel{font-size:.8rem;width:57%}#btn-pixel2{font-size:.8rem;width:45%}.vector{margin:0;width:16px}.vector2{margin-left:10px;width:20px}.section1-2{width:100%}.section2-1{font-size:.5rem;gap:0}form{margin-top:-30%;padding:7%}.filtro{height:115vh}.ventajas{align-items:center;flex-direction:column;font-size:.5rem;gap:25px;justify-content:space-between;padding-top:1.8rem}.ventajas img{width:50%}.textVent{font-size:.5rem}.contVentajasText{display:flex;flex-direction:column;gap:10px;height:100%;padding:0}.boton{margin-top:180px}.botonhero2{margin-top:-135px}.sobreNosotrosTitulo{text-align:center}.sobreNosotrosTitulo2{font-size:2.2rem;text-align:center}.textNosotros{font-size:1rem;text-align:center}.section2-2{display:flex;flex-direction:row;flex-wrap:wrap}.section1{background-position:top;background-size:cover}.section3{height:200vh}.infoImgQuienesSomos{flex-direction:column;justify-content:space-around;margin-top:10%}.info{padding-top:7%}.info,.info2{width:100%}.info2 img{width:80%}.textNosotros{margin:0}.herramientasusadas{margin-bottom:1%;margin-top:3%}.contHerramientas{height:60%;padding-left:10px;padding-right:10px}.herramientas{margin-top:17%}.herrameinta{height:25px;width:120px}.imgHerr{width:30px}.nameHerr{font-size:.6rem;text-align:end}.proyectos{margin-top:-50px}.proyectosCont{align-items:center;flex-direction:column;gap:10px;width:100%}.proyectosTitulo{margin-bottom:2%;margin-top:2%}.itemProyecto{padding:5px;width:330px}.imgTecnos{width:300px!important}.review{align-items:center;display:flex;flex-direction:column;height:65vh;margin-top:100%;padding-right:0!important}.textoComent{font-size:.9rem!important;padding:20px 0 0!important;text-align:center}.review .review-slider{margin-left:0;margin-right:0;width:85%}.contBoton{justify-content:center;width:100%}.botonfinal,.contBoton{align-items:center;display:flex}.botonfinal{justify-content:center!important;margin:0;padding-bottom:4%}.review .slide .user img{height:6rem;padding:5px;width:6rem}.review .slide .user h3{color:#333;color:var(--black);font-size:1rem;padding-bottom:.5rem}.textoComentarios{font-size:.8rem!important}.footerLinks{flex-direction:row;flex-wrap:wrap;gap:5%;height:35%;justify-content:center;padding-top:5%}.footerLinks a{font-size:.8rem}.footerRedes{display:flex;flex-direction:column;padding:0;width:100%}.footerRedes a{width:100%!important}.botonhero5,.footerRedes a{display:flex;justify-content:center}.botonhero5{align-items:center;font-size:1rem;gap:8%;height:40px;width:80%}.footerSection1{font-size:1rem;padding:5px}.spanFooter{color:#0080ff;font-size:1rem;font-weight:700}.text2Footer{font-size:.6rem}.textFooter{font-size:.35rem}.logoFoter{width:120px}.botonhero4{margin-top:5%}}@media (min-width:851px) and (max-width:1086px){.section1-2{padding:120px 5vw 0}.textHero1{font-size:1.9rem}.email{margin-top:7vh}.vector{display:none}}@media (min-width:850px) and (max-width:1600px){.botonhero4{margin-right:-280%}.footerLinks{gap:10px;justify-content:center}.footerRedes{gap:10%;margin-right:15%!important;width:100%}.botonhero5{width:120%}.vector{display:none}}@media (min-height:320px) and (max-height:750px){.section2-1{height:35vh;padding-top:0!important}.section1{height:100vh;padding-top:0}.section1-2{padding-top:7%}.section2-1{height:35vh;padding-top:10%}.section2-2{height:55vh}.contVentajasText{align-items:center;margin:0!important;padding:5px;width:100%}#app-header{height:13vh;padding:0!important}.email{margin-top:1%}form{margin-top:-10%}form h2{font-size:1rem}.col-auto{margin:0}#btn-pixel,#btn-pixel2{font-size:.7rem}.vector{width:20px}.filtro{height:100%}.contVentajasText{margin-right:10px;text-align:start}.botonhero2{margin-bottom:7%}.info2 img{width:90%}.sobreNosotrosTitulo2{font-size:1.9rem}.textNosotros{font-size:.9rem}.imgHerr{width:35px}.botonfinal{display:flex;height:100%;justify-content:start;margin:0;width:100%}.review{padding-right:10%;width:100%}.review .review-slider{width:85%}.footerSection1{justify-content:space-between;padding-bottom:6%;padding-top:3%}.footerSection1 p{margin:0}}
/*# sourceMappingURL=main.2ac1f66b.css.map*/